It was so awesome I could hardly believe we were there seeing and experiencing it all. Now, I know that trips, especially trips like this, are horrible for diets. So, good thing I'm not on a diet, but rather am in the midst of changing my lifestyle. I had a few people tell me to expect to gain a few pounds but to not get discouraged. I had others tell me to keep track of my points no matter what happened with my weight. And still a few others who told me to keep thinking I would lose, or at least maintain, and that that would help me not to gorge while I was abroad.
I did keep track of my points- well, as best I could. Some things over there were not on the Weight Watchers website and since I wasn't always sure of what I was eating I did my best to guesstimate. In the meantime, my dad and I walked all over each city. We took a few bus tours here and there- oh and the Sound of Music Tour- lifelong dream right there, folks. Huge fan. HUGE FAN. What I did on the days when I knew we couldn't guarantee a ton of walking was to eat smaller portions. I didn't deny myself the experience of trying what I wanted to try or eating what I wanted to eat. I simply took smaller amounts or split the meal with my dad.
It worked. I lost 1.5 pounds during my trip. I have never been quite so proud of myself.
